react-native-streaming-audio-player npm version

Streaming audio player for iOS + Android

Features

  • Play remote streaming audio source
  • Handle audio focus for...
    • incoming and outgoing calls
    • switching application contexts
  • Control audio from notification and lock screen (Android)
  • Control audio from control center and lock screen (iOS)
  • Control audio from headsets

Installation

First, install the library from npm:

npm install react-native-streaming-audio-player --save

Second, link the native dependencies.

react-native link react-native-streaming-audio-player

Running a sample app

In the Example directory:

cd Examples
npm install
react-native run-ios or run-android

Usage

import Player from 'react-native-streaming-audio-player';

export default class Example extends Component {
  constructor(props) {
    super(props);
    this.state = { currentTime: 0 }
    this.onUpdatePosition = this.onUpdatePosition.bind(this);
  }

  onPlay() {
    Player.play(source.url, {
      title: source,
      artist: source.artist,
      album_art_uri: source.arworkUrl,
    });
  }

  onPause() {
    Player.pause();
  }

  render() {
    return (
      <View style={styles.container}>
        <View style={{ flexDirection: 'row', alignSelf: 'stretch', justifyContent: 'space-around' }}>
          <Button
            title='Play'
            onPress={() => this.onPlay()}
            color='red'
          />
          <Button
            title='Pause'
            onPress={() => this.onPause()}
            color='red'
          />
        </View>
      </View>
    );
  }
}

const styles = StyleSheet.create({
  container: {
    flex: 1,
    justifyContent: 'center',
    alignItems: 'center',
  },
});

API and Configuration

Player Control

  • play(url: string, metadata: object)
    • metadata.title
    • metadata.artist
    • metadata.album_art_uri
  • pause()
  • stop()

Callbacks

  • onPlaybackStateChanged
  • onUpdatePosition

PlaybackState

  • NONE
  • PLAYING
  • BUFFERING
  • PAUSED
  • STOPPED
  • COMPLETED

PlayerAction

  • Play
  • Pause
  • SkipToNext
  • SkipToPrevious
